На главную страницу Версия-Т
VTSoft.ru

остановки при загрузке товаров в РШК-5Е


RSS
остановки при загрузке товаров в РШК-5Е
 
При выгрузки достаточно большой (3000-4000 наименований) базы в РШК-5Е наблюдается следующая картина: процесс выгрузки останавливается в произвольном месте и выводится "ошибка связи с удаленной базой". Иногда процесс проходит удачно. При этом связь с РШК вроде как стабильная (по крайней мере пингуется без пропусков).
Что посоветуете предпринять?
 
Ответ отправлен на e-mail
 
Не могли бы Вы и мне отправить ответ на этот вопрос или опубликовать его в форуме. Похоже, что у меня такая же ситуация (Ранее я задавал вопрос по сети ККМ)
 
Цитата
vitaliys писал(а):
Не могли бы Вы и мне отправить ответ на этот вопрос или опубликовать его в форуме. Похоже, что у меня такая же ситуация (Ранее я задавал вопрос по сети ККМ)


в качестве ответа мне выслали EXE от AMSBASE версии 5.4.3 (кстати эта версия почему то так и не появилась на сайте) и рекомендовали включить в amsbase.ini строки:
[РШК-5Е]
TimeOut=20000

немного помогло, но иногда сбои остались

опытным путем я заметил у себя одну особенность РШК: первый пакет с конкретно взятого компьютера (если до этого кто то из них выключался - или компьютер или РШК) не проходит (легко проверяется ping-ом). Все остальные - на ура. Т.е. если сразу после включения компьютера запустить обмен с РШК, то он закончится "ошибкой связи с удаленной базой". У себя я это вылечил предварительной "пропинговкой" РШК перед началом обмена.
Является ли это конструктивной особенностью РШК или это особенности его работы конкретно у меня (пробовал на 2-х экземплярах) не знаю.
Но сбои все равно редко, но бывают. При программном вызове OLE-сервера AMSBASE иногда(но правда совсем редко) обмен прекращается, но в сервер остается в "подвисшем" состоянии, не сообщая ни признака ошибки ни признака завершения обмена. В чем причина - еще не выяснил, может и я что неправильно делаю
(хотя вроде как все строго по хелпу и по примеру).
 
У меня тоже были похожие проблеммы.(правда я работал с оффлайн библиотеками). И вот какие выводы я в то время сделал:
1. То, что первый пакет к РШК не проходит - конструктивная особеннось, и ничего, кроме пинга, с ней не поделать.
2. РШК "не любит" некоторые модели сетевых карточек. В моем случае это была "Intel EtherExpress 10-t". При работе с нею РШК периодически пропадал или пропускал пакеты. После замены сетевой карточки на компьютере, все как рукой сняло.